DVD WARNING The Contender release of "The Definitive Dossier" is missing scenes and has encoding problems on some players - don't buy them until they're re-released later this year. Dossier 2 has been put back in the schedule until the problems are fixed. Read all about it at David K. Smith's 'Avengers Forever!' site.

Frank Elrick (The Bird Who Knew Too Much) has been identified as Patrick McGoohan's long-time stunt double Frank Maher - he also appears in You Have Just Been Murdered.

2 February 2001

Kim Howard has pointed me in the right direction and I've identified Steed's car at the end of The Cybernauts as a Talbot 16hp from 1909. (Talbots were derived from the Gallic lines of the Darracq, the 1909 16hp being the first of their cars entirely built in Britain, previous models having coachwork and mechanicals from French manufacturers; so it's no wonder I thought it was a Renault).
